    The Trace The Supreme Court on March 26 upheld a Biden administration rule targeting the proliferation of unserialized, untraceable “ghost guns,” allowing federal authorities to regulate the sale of kits and parts used to assemble the weapons. The 7-2 decision in Bondi v. VanDerStok allows the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ives to enforce a 2022 regulation aimed at addressing what law enforcement has described as a growing public safety crisis.

    The Trace President Donald Trump’s February 24 appointment of FBI Director Kash Patel to also serve as acting chief of the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ives has stirred fears among former ATF officials and gun violence prevention advocates about a dramatic shakeup at the nation’s top gun regulator. Patel will lead a workforce of more than 5,000 ATF employees charged with investigating violent gun crime and regulating the country’s sprawling firearms industry.
